Analysis
Ghana recorded 926,413 1000 SLC for oranges — gross production value in 2024. That is the highest value across all 34 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 4.2% on the previous year and up 99.4% over ten years.
Over the whole period, oranges — gross production value in Ghana peaked at 926,413 1000 SLC in 2024 and was at its lowest, 77 1000 SLC, in 1991.
That places Ghana 50th out of 98 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 3,192 1000 SLC | 77 1000 SLC | 9,236 1000 SLC | 9 |
| 2000s | 74,717 1000 SLC | 15,120 1000 SLC | 144,760 1000 SLC | 10 |
| 2010s | 502,652 1000 SLC | 209,670 1000 SLC | 813,660 1000 SLC | 10 |
| 2020s | 867,937 1000 SLC | 774,256 1000 SLC | 926,413 1000 SLC | 5 |

About this data
The domain provides detailed data on the value of agricultural production that is calculated by the agricultural production data and the price data at farm gate. Thus, the value of production measures the agricultural production in monetary terms at the farm gate level.
